From a technical perspective, LIXT is testing a critical support zone around $5.32, a level that has acted as a floor on several occasions in recent months. A sustained break below this area could open the door to further downside toward the $5.00 psychological level. Conversely, the $5.88 resistance remains the immediate hurdle for any recovery attempt.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is in the low-to-mid 30s, indicating bearish momentum territory but not yet oversold.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) has turned negative, with the signal line crossing below the histogram, reinforcing a short-term bearish trend. On the daily chart, LIXT has formed a series of lower highs and lower lows since mid-month, a classic downtrend pattern. Volume patterns show spikes on down days, which typically confirm selling pressure rather than accumulation. However, the stock remains above its 200-day moving average, which lies near $5.45, providing a secondary support level that has not yet been breached. A bounce from current levels could initially face resistance at $5.65 and then $5.88, with the latter representing a potential breakout point if buying momentum returns.

Looking ahead, LIXT’s price trajectory may hinge on whether the $5.32 support holds in the coming sessions. If buyers defend that level, the stock could stage a short-term bounce toward $5.88, though any rally would need confirmation from a reduction in selling volume. Alternatively, a decisive break below $5.32 could lead to a retest of the $5.00 area, which served as support in early October. The stock’s sensitivity to news makes upcoming corporate updates a potentially significant catalyst. Investors should also monitor the broader risk environment for small-cap biotechs, as sector rotation could amplify moves. The company has no major earnings scheduled in the near term, but any announcement regarding clinical trial progress or partnership developments could quickly alter the technical setup. A recovery above $5.88 would shift the outlook to a more neutral stance, while a move below $5.32 may signal further downside. As always, price discovery in thinly traded names like LIXT can be abrupt, so cautious positioning is warranted.
